It looks like dippy is leading with seven visits so far. I too have seen those same covers and tonight we had Greg Bernstein replacing Christopher Howell as Bert Barry. He was very good although seemed somewhat younger than Christopher Howell which slightly unbalanced his pairing with the amazing Jasnar Ivir as Maggie, but it was fine. The audience was smallish, but what they lacked in quantity they made up for in lively responses to all the numbers. Maybe it's like that every night but the punters did seem very enthusiastic, more so than last Monday night with lots of cheering throughout the whole show and also some intermediate cheering at key points during the finale. Tonight I specially admired all the costumes, particularly Sheena Easton's dresses. Also, tonight for the first time I spotted Clare Halse executing a fine jetée during the 'Go into your dance' routine but I nearly missed it so that's my excuse now to go and see the show again so I can watch it properly! The show just gets better and better and my imagination was running riot because I kept on thinking that there were more dancers on stage than before. I know that's not possible but it seemed like there were multitudes of them! Again it's surely my imagination but I got a bit more out of Clare Halse's performance tonight than I did the first few times I saw her. I spoke briefly to Jae Alexander at the end of the performance before he left the pit and told him the continuing success of the show was entirely down to him and he seemed pleased! A0 (first time) was cramped as expected but as soon as the band struck up I completely forgot about the restricted leg room.
